From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S936716Ab3DIOu1 (ORCPT ); Tue, 9 Apr 2013 10:50:27 -0400 Received: from merlin.infradead.org ([205.233.59.134]:33171 "EHLO merlin.infradead.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S933250Ab3DIOu0 (ORCPT ); Tue, 9 Apr 2013 10:50:26 -0400 Date: Tue, 9 Apr 2013 16:50:07 +0200 From: Jens Axboe To: Linus Torvalds Cc: linux-kernel@vger.kernel.org Subject: [GIT PULL] Final block fixes for 3.9 Message-ID: <20130409145007.GI12244@kernel.dk>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Linus, I've got a few smaller fixes queued up for 3.9 that should go in. The major one is the loop regression, the others are nice fixes on their own though. It contains: - Fix for unitialized var in the block sysfs code, courtesy of Arnd and gcc-4.8. - Two fixes for mtip32xx, fixing probe and command timeout. Also a debug measure that could have waited for 3.10, but it's driver only, so I let it slip in. - Revert the loop partition cleanup fix, it could cause a deadlock on auto-teardown as part of umount. The fix is clear, but at this point we just want to revert it and get a real fix in for 3.10. Please pull! Tag is signed. git://git.kernel.dk/linux-block.git tags/for-linus-20130409 ---------------------------------------------------------------- for-linus-20130409 ---------------------------------------------------------------- Arnd Bergmann (1): block: avoid using uninitialized value in from queue_var_store Asai Thambi S P (3): mtip32xx: recovery from command timeout mtip32xx: return 0 from pci probe in case of rebuild mtip32xx: Add debugfs entry device_status Jens Axboe (2): mtip32xx: fix two smatch warnings Revert "loop: cleanup partitions when detaching loop device" block/blk-sysfs.c | 2 + block/partition-generic.c | 1 - drivers/block/loop.c | 21 +-- drivers/block/mtip32xx/mtip32xx.c | 327 +++++++++++++++++++++++++++----------- drivers/block/mtip32xx/mtip32xx.h | 18 ++- 5 files changed, 247 insertions(+), 122 deletions(-) -- Jens Axboe